:1fishing1: just an update between the pissing torrents from the gods weve had for the last 2 weeks-heaps of bream around-my best just over 1.3kg(gilled and gutted) this week---the bream are all in the bigger catagory which is unusual for this time of year as these fish are normally here in winter-you can catch a bucket full of whiting in the river if you want to-------a few good fish have come in when having 'a spin" on the local reef at low tide--------Gts to 4kgs--kings to 5kgs and the odd "chopper" tailor with the best yesterday weighed in at 4.2kgs(gilled and gutted)------no ones been able to have a real serious crack at jew on the beach owing to the conditions -a few flatties have turned up this week with 6 caught that I know of today--just a bit to add thats happened on tuesday------

on monday a guy rocked down to where i was fishing and tried to pick my brain as to what was going on-after an hour or so he seemed a decent guy-so i gave him"the oil"as to how to fish the spot i was at----I also showed him where my catch(8 bream) was "hidden"to prove that what i was showing and telling him was true----he had just moved up from sydney to live at lennox and wanted to learn how to fish a bit------the next day he rocked down to the spot at the exact time i did-at least he listened to the bit i told him(1 hour before the high is the go)---he had bought a K-mart rod and reel-spooled with 25lb line------plus he had bought some hooks sinkers and "whitebait"--------I got into the bream straight away(I fish lite for em-4kg line)----on his second chuk he had a huge bend in his rod-I said-got a snag ay???-----he said no-its moving-------I said must be a lump of kelp------he said maybe-----well after about 10 minutes of him stuffing around I'd thought I'd help him a bit-------after me grabbing his rod to "bust him off a rock"i felt movement-then i unlocked his drag that was locked tight-------after about 5 mins i gave the rod back to him-with lots of instructions on how to play the fish-basically-he had all day-the fish didnt----------he did well-I had no idea what it was but put my $$ on a ray of some sort-------to cut another 15 mins of story short----one very novice fisho with very average gear went home with one crocadile dusky lizard--------it hit the scales at 6.2kg-(gilled and gutted)---the guys name is Barry-and he was still smiling around town today----He rekons Lennox is a top joint-------wonder why???????------- :1prop:

:1prop: Lennox at times is a fishing "heaven"-today at my local 'fishing comp'-Lennox point hotel fishing club" this week end-------bream to 1kg-trevally to 1 kilo-whiting to 350gms-flathead to 2kgs-jew to 6kgs and golden trevally to 3.5kgs were weighed in-all fish weighed in here in all comps-from evans head to byron-are "gilled and gutted" weights-----another thing-thats interesting-------the lengths of weigh in fish-bream-whiting-tailor-are all more than the legal limits as set-----and the rule applies-try to weigh in a "non long enough fish"-you get banned forever from the club-theres only one bloke i know whos come to Lennox for a stay and gone home without catching a decent fish-----i think he a mate of jimbos!!!!!!!----------I'm in trouble now!!!!!!! :thumbup:
